it would help to know what kind of orchid you have as different orchids require different care. Hafing said that, the kind of leaf drop you're talking about can be caused by root loss. Being in a container that does not drain is ideal for causing root loss due to rot.

i suspect that if you pull the plant out fo the pot you will find most if not all of the roots to be mushy and grey/black. If that is the case, cut them off. Leave any that are white/cream/green and firm or crispy.
